alibaba / jetcache
File Size

The distribution of size of files (measured in lines of code).

Intro
Learn more...
File Size Overall
0% | 0% | 24% | 28% | 47%
Legend:
1001+
501-1000
201-500
101-200
1-100


explore: grouped by folders | grouped by size | sunburst | 3D view
File Size per Extension
1001+
501-1000
201-500
101-200
1-100
java0% | 0% | 24% | 28% | 47%
File Size per Logical Decomposition
primary
1001+
501-1000
201-500
101-200
1-100
jetcache-core0% | 0% | 25% | 32% | 42%
jetcache-support0% | 0% | 56% | 11% | 31%
jetcache-anno0% | 0% | 10% | 33% | 55%
jetcache-starter0% | 0% | 0% | 29% | 70%
jetcache-anno-api0% | 0% | 0% | 0% | 100%
jetcache-test0% | 0% | 0% | 0% | 100%
Longest Files (Top 50)
File# lines# units
RedisCache.java
in jetcache-support/jetcache-redis/src/main/java/com/alicp/jetcache/redis
402 20
AbstractCache.java
in jetcache-core/src/main/java/com/alicp/jetcache
316 20
RedisLettuceCache.java
in jetcache-support/jetcache-redis-lettuce/src/main/java/com/alicp/jetcache/redis/lettuce
290 11
CacheStat.java
in jetcache-core/src/main/java/com/alicp/jetcache/support
271 69
CacheHandler.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/method
259 16
DefaultCacheMonitor.java
in jetcache-core/src/main/java/com/alicp/jetcache/support
231 14
RefreshCache.java
in jetcache-core/src/main/java/com/alicp/jetcache
228 18
MultiLevelCache.java
in jetcache-core/src/main/java/com/alicp/jetcache
224 21
RedisSpringDataCache.java
in jetcache-support/jetcache-redis-springdata/src/main/java/com/alicp/jetcache/redis/springdata
220 11
RedissonCache.java
in jetcache-support/jetcache-redisson/src/main/java/com/alicp/jetcache/redisson
213 15
QuickConfig.java
in jetcache-core/src/main/java/com/alicp/jetcache/template
186 34
CachePointcut.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/aop
180 12
SimpleCacheManager.java
in jetcache-core/src/main/java/com/alicp/jetcache
174 13
RedisAutoConfiguration.java
in jetcache-starter/jetcache-autoconfigure/src/main/java/com/alicp/jetcache/autoconfigure
170 6
CacheConfigUtil.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/method
160 8
Cache.java
in jetcache-core/src/main/java/com/alicp/jetcache
157 15
LinkedHashMapCache.java
in jetcache-core/src/main/java/com/alicp/jetcache/embedded
152 15
CreateCacheAnnotationBeanPostProcessor.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/field
152 9
StatInfoLogger.java
in jetcache-core/src/main/java/com/alicp/jetcache/support
138 7
RedisBroadcastManager.java
in jetcache-support/jetcache-redis/src/main/java/com/alicp/jetcache/redis
129 8
RedisLettuceAutoConfiguration.java
in jetcache-starter/jetcache-autoconfigure/src/main/java/com/alicp/jetcache/autoconfigure
128 5
AbstractJsonEncoder.java
in jetcache-core/src/main/java/com/alicp/jetcache/support
127 8
DefaultMetricsManager.java
in jetcache-core/src/main/java/com/alicp/jetcache/support
127 10
CacheContext.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/support
124 11
ConfigProvider.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/support
124 17
CacheConfig.java
in jetcache-core/src/main/java/com/alicp/jetcache
121 29
AbstractEmbeddedCache.java
in jetcache-core/src/main/java/com/alicp/jetcache/embedded
120 12
SimpleProxyCache.java
in jetcache-core/src/main/java/com/alicp/jetcache
119 28
CacheNotifyMonitor.java
in jetcache-core/src/main/java/com/alicp/jetcache/support
108 5
LettuceConnectionManager.java
in jetcache-support/jetcache-redis-lettuce/src/main/java/com/alicp/jetcache/redis/lettuce
106 9
AbstractCacheBuilder.java
in jetcache-core/src/main/java/com/alicp/jetcache
106 22
CachedAnnoConfig.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/support
105 28
DefaultCacheNameGenerator.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/support
99 5
SpringDataBroadcastManager.java
in jetcache-support/jetcache-redis-springdata/src/main/java/com/alicp/jetcache/redis/springdata
97 5
ExpressionEvaluator.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/method
97 8
LoadingCache.java
in jetcache-core/src/main/java/com/alicp/jetcache
92 4
BroadcastManager.java
in jetcache-core/src/main/java/com/alicp/jetcache/support
91 7
LettuceBroadcastManager.java
in jetcache-support/jetcache-redis-lettuce/src/main/java/com/alicp/jetcache/redis/lettuce
86 4
ConfigTree.java
in jetcache-starter/jetcache-autoconfigure/src/main/java/com/alicp/jetcache/autoconfigure
86 12
CacheUtil.java
in jetcache-core/src/main/java/com/alicp/jetcache
85 3
CaffeineCache.java
in jetcache-core/src/main/java/com/alicp/jetcache/embedded
83 3
JetCacheExecutor.java
in jetcache-core/src/main/java/com/alicp/jetcache/support
82 5
DefaultEncoderParser.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/support
81 5
AbstractCacheAutoInit.java
in jetcache-starter/jetcache-autoconfigure/src/main/java/com/alicp/jetcache/autoconfigure
78 4
ExpressionUtil.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/method
78 4
RedisCacheBuilder.java
in jetcache-support/jetcache-redis/src/main/java/com/alicp/jetcache/redis
76 17
CreateCacheWrapper.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/field
72 3
JetCacheAutoConfiguration.java
in jetcache-starter/jetcache-autoconfigure/src/main/java/com/alicp/jetcache/autoconfigure
71 5
AbstractJsonDecoder.java
in jetcache-core/src/main/java/com/alicp/jetcache/support
71 5
RedissonBroadcastManager.java
in jetcache-support/jetcache-redisson/src/main/java/com/alicp/jetcache/redisson
70 4
Files With Most Units (Top 50)
File# lines# units
CacheStat.java
in jetcache-core/src/main/java/com/alicp/jetcache/support
271 69
QuickConfig.java
in jetcache-core/src/main/java/com/alicp/jetcache/template
186 34
CacheConfig.java
in jetcache-core/src/main/java/com/alicp/jetcache
121 29
SimpleProxyCache.java
in jetcache-core/src/main/java/com/alicp/jetcache
119 28
CachedAnnoConfig.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/support
105 28
AbstractCacheBuilder.java
in jetcache-core/src/main/java/com/alicp/jetcache
106 22
MultiLevelCache.java
in jetcache-core/src/main/java/com/alicp/jetcache
224 21
RedisCache.java
in jetcache-support/jetcache-redis/src/main/java/com/alicp/jetcache/redis
402 20
AbstractCache.java
in jetcache-core/src/main/java/com/alicp/jetcache
316 20
RefreshCache.java
in jetcache-core/src/main/java/com/alicp/jetcache
228 18
RedisCacheBuilder.java
in jetcache-support/jetcache-redis/src/main/java/com/alicp/jetcache/redis
76 17
ConfigProvider.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/support
124 17
CacheAnnoConfig.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/support
62 16
CacheHandler.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/method
259 16
RedisLettuceCacheBuilder.java
in jetcache-support/jetcache-redis-lettuce/src/main/java/com/alicp/jetcache/redis/lettuce
68 15
RedissonCache.java
in jetcache-support/jetcache-redisson/src/main/java/com/alicp/jetcache/redisson
213 15
Cache.java
in jetcache-core/src/main/java/com/alicp/jetcache
157 15
LinkedHashMapCache.java
in jetcache-core/src/main/java/com/alicp/jetcache/embedded
152 15
CacheInvokeContext.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/method
66 15
DefaultCacheMonitor.java
in jetcache-core/src/main/java/com/alicp/jetcache/support
231 14
GlobalCacheConfig.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/support
59 14
CacheResult.java
in jetcache-core/src/main/java/com/alicp/jetcache
69 13
SimpleCacheManager.java
in jetcache-core/src/main/java/com/alicp/jetcache
174 13
ConfigTree.java
in jetcache-starter/jetcache-autoconfigure/src/main/java/com/alicp/jetcache/autoconfigure
86 12
AbstractEmbeddedCache.java
in jetcache-core/src/main/java/com/alicp/jetcache/embedded
120 12
CachePointcut.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/aop
180 12
RedisSpringDataCache.java
in jetcache-support/jetcache-redis-springdata/src/main/java/com/alicp/jetcache/redis/springdata
220 11
RedisLettuceCache.java
in jetcache-support/jetcache-redis-lettuce/src/main/java/com/alicp/jetcache/redis/lettuce
290 11
JetCacheProperties.java
in jetcache-starter/jetcache-autoconfigure/src/main/java/com/alicp/jetcache/autoconfigure
45 11
RefreshPolicy.java
in jetcache-core/src/main/java/com/alicp/jetcache
48 11
MultiLevelCacheBuilder.java
in jetcache-core/src/main/java/com/alicp/jetcache
53 11
CacheContext.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/support
124 11
RedisLettuceCacheConfig.java
in jetcache-support/jetcache-redis-lettuce/src/main/java/com/alicp/jetcache/redis/lettuce
43 10
CacheMessage.java
in jetcache-core/src/main/java/com/alicp/jetcache/support
51 10
DefaultMetricsManager.java
in jetcache-core/src/main/java/com/alicp/jetcache/support
127 10
RedisSpringDataCacheBuilder.java
in jetcache-support/jetcache-redis-springdata/src/main/java/com/alicp/jetcache/redis/springdata
46 9
LettuceConnectionManager.java
in jetcache-support/jetcache-redis-lettuce/src/main/java/com/alicp/jetcache/redis/lettuce
106 9
RedisCacheConfig.java
in jetcache-support/jetcache-redis/src/main/java/com/alicp/jetcache/redis
49 9
ResultData.java
in jetcache-core/src/main/java/com/alicp/jetcache
36 9
DecoderMap.java
in jetcache-core/src/main/java/com/alicp/jetcache/support
55 9
CreateCacheAnnotationBeanPostProcessor.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/field
152 9
CacheInvokeConfig.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/method
39 9
RedisBroadcastManager.java
in jetcache-support/jetcache-redis/src/main/java/com/alicp/jetcache/redis
129 8
CacheValueHolder.java
in jetcache-core/src/main/java/com/alicp/jetcache
33 8
AbstractJsonEncoder.java
in jetcache-core/src/main/java/com/alicp/jetcache/support
127 8
CacheGetResult.java
in jetcache-core/src/main/java/com/alicp/jetcache
44 8
CacheConfigUtil.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/method
160 8
ExpressionEvaluator.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/method
97 8
Kryo5ValueEncoder.java
in jetcache-core/src/main/java/com/alicp/jetcache/support
65 7
KryoValueEncoder.java
in jetcache-core/src/main/java/com/alicp/jetcache/support
67 7
Files With Long Lines (Top 28)

There are 28 files with lines longer than 120 characters. In total, there are 68 long lines.

File# lines# units# long lines
RedisLettuceCache.java
in jetcache-support/jetcache-redis-lettuce/src/main/java/com/alicp/jetcache/redis/lettuce
290 11 7
RedissonCache.java
in jetcache-support/jetcache-redisson/src/main/java/com/alicp/jetcache/redisson
213 15 5
RedisCache.java
in jetcache-support/jetcache-redis/src/main/java/com/alicp/jetcache/redis
402 20 5
RedisLettuceAutoConfiguration.java
in jetcache-starter/jetcache-autoconfigure/src/main/java/com/alicp/jetcache/autoconfigure
128 5 5
CacheHandler.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/method
259 16 5
StatInfoLogger.java
in jetcache-core/src/main/java/com/alicp/jetcache/support
138 7 4
ExpressionUtil.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/method
78 4 4
RedisAutoConfiguration.java
in jetcache-starter/jetcache-autoconfigure/src/main/java/com/alicp/jetcache/autoconfigure
170 6 3
Cache.java
in jetcache-core/src/main/java/com/alicp/jetcache
157 15 3
CacheAnnotationParser.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/config
59 2 3
CacheConfigUtil.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/method
160 8 3
JetCacheCondition.java
in jetcache-starter/jetcache-autoconfigure/src/main/java/com/alicp/jetcache/autoconfigure
32 3 2
RedissonAutoConfiguration.java
in jetcache-starter/jetcache-autoconfigure/src/main/java/com/alicp/jetcache/autoconfigure
59 5 2
AbstractCache.java
in jetcache-core/src/main/java/com/alicp/jetcache
316 20 2
CacheContext.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/support
124 11 2
RedisSpringDataCacheBuilder.java
in jetcache-support/jetcache-redis-springdata/src/main/java/com/alicp/jetcache/redis/springdata
46 9 1
LettuceBroadcastManager.java
in jetcache-support/jetcache-redis-lettuce/src/main/java/com/alicp/jetcache/redis/lettuce
86 4 1
RedissonBroadcastManager.java
in jetcache-support/jetcache-redisson/src/main/java/com/alicp/jetcache/redisson
70 4 1
RedisSpringDataAutoConfiguration.java
in jetcache-starter/jetcache-autoconfigure/src/main/java/com/alicp/jetcache/autoconfigure
59 5 1
SimpleProxyCache.java
in jetcache-core/src/main/java/com/alicp/jetcache
119 28 1
Kryo5ValueEncoder.java
in jetcache-core/src/main/java/com/alicp/jetcache/support
65 7 1
JavaValueEncoder.java
in jetcache-core/src/main/java/com/alicp/jetcache/support
48 3 1
BroadcastManager.java
in jetcache-core/src/main/java/com/alicp/jetcache/support
91 7 1
MultiLevelCache.java
in jetcache-core/src/main/java/com/alicp/jetcache
224 21 1
LinkedHashMapCache.java
in jetcache-core/src/main/java/com/alicp/jetcache/embedded
152 15 1
CacheGetResult.java
in jetcache-core/src/main/java/com/alicp/jetcache
44 8 1
SimpleCacheManager.java
in jetcache-core/src/main/java/com/alicp/jetcache
174 13 1
CreateCacheAnnotationBeanPostProcessor.java
in jetcache-anno/src/main/java/com/alicp/jetcache/anno/field
152 9 1